15 LTA Standards and Practices
Practice 2 G Standard 9 Practice 9 G Director’s Office Various files and correspondence 3 years to Permanent Administrator’s Office Budgets, timesheets 5-7 years GIS Office Maps Permanent Land Stewardship Program Return to Municipal Assistant Program Publications, correspondence, various files 7 years to permanent Tip: Older land trusts may not have Baseline Documentation Reports (BDRs) for easements granted prior to February 13, 1986, as the IRS did not require them until that time. For accreditation purposes, until a BDR is created, Baseline Documentation itself should suffice in these instances (field maps, notes, photos from background files).

16 LTA Standards and Practices
Practice 9 G “Pursuant to its records policy (see practice 2 D) the land trust keeps originals of all irreplaceable documents essential to the defense of each transaction (such as legal agreements, critical correspondence and appraisals) in one location, and copies in a separate location. Original documents are protected from daily use and are secure from fire, floods and other damage.” - LTA Standards and Practices Director’s Office Various files and correspondence 3 years to Permanent Administrator’s Office Budgets, timesheets 5-7 years GIS Office Maps Permanent Land Stewardship Program Return to Municipal Assistant Program Publications, correspondence, various files 7 years to permanent
